Web8 feb. 2024 · Sweet potatoes and potatoes contain are nearly identical in their carbohydrate content, providing around 21g of carbs per 100g serving. However, white potatoes are about 2.5 times higher in starch than sweet potatoes. In fact, starch makes up for the 95 percent of carbohydrates found in white potatoes. WebThey have roughly the same amount of calories, carbohydrates, and protein — and they are both good sources of vitamin B6, magnesium, and potassium. Plus, both potatoes and sweet potatoes also contain resistant starch, a type of starch that is digested more slowly and has many health benefits.
